Breakthrough T1D, formerly JDRF, invites fashion lovers and philanthropic shoppers to turn style into impact at Style for a Cure, a chic, day-long shopping celebration at River Oaks District on February 10, 2026, from 11 a.m. to 7 p.m. The fashionable affair will raise critical funds for Breakthrough T1D while setting the tone for the highly anticipated “Night in Black & White” 2026 Promise Ball.
Hosted by acclaimed personal stylist Styled by Dale (Dale Volpe) alongside 2026 Promise Ball Chairs Alexandra and Richard Bruskoff, the event transforms River Oaks District into a runway of retail indulgence. Guests will enjoy a full day of exclusive in-store activations, light bites, bubbly sips, giveaways, raffles, and endless style inspiration—all while shopping for a cause. Twenty percent of all purchases throughout the day will benefit Greater Houston Breakthrough T1D.
More than 20 coveted boutiques will participate, including A.L.C., alice + olivia, Altuzurra, Assouline, Baccarat, Biologique Recherche, Carolina Herrera, Christy Lynn, Frame, LoveShackFancy, Maison Francis Kurkdjian, Moreau, Veronica Beard, Vince, Zadig & Voltaire, Zimmerman, and more—offering everything from statement-making fashion to beauty must-haves and luxury gifts. Breakthrough T1D will mark the 27th anniversary of one of Houston’s most successful philanthropic evenings—the Promise Ball—on Saturday, April 11, 2026, at the Hilton Americas–Houston.
This year’s celebration will honor The Judy & Bob Morgan family and The Amy & Tim Haskell family, while also recognizing Linda Brown with the prestigious Meredith and Fielding Cocke Visionary Award. In addition, Elizabeth & James Elder will be highlighted as the evening’s Fund A Cure family.
